A beautifully appointed three/four bedroom detached chalet-style residence enviably located in the much favoured Summerdown area, within a few hundred yards of The Royal Eastbourne Golf Course. The house has been the subject of considerable improvement by the present owners over the past few years and is presented for sale in what is considered to be show home condition. The ground floor accommodation is set around a generous reception hall and includes a delightful 20' x 17' living room with triple aspect windows, two bedrooms, a bathroom, a recently re-fitted kitchen/breakfast room and a utility room. The kitchen has been thoughtfully planned and has a comprehensive range of wall and base units beneath contoured work surfaces together with a breakfast bar. Integrated appliances include a double oven, hob, dishwasher and fridge, whilst the utility room is plumbed for a washing machine with space for a fridge/freezer. There are two further double bedrooms and a beautifully appointed shower room on the first floor. The house is flanked by attractive gardens to all sides that are primarily laid to lawn, with an enclosed area to the southerly side of the house. Other benefits include a double garage, with additional off-road parking, gas central heating and sealed unit double glazing. Enjoying a convenient and highly desirable location, approximately 1 mile from Eastbourne town centre and railway station, local shopping facilities include a Waitrose store whilst the much in demand Gildredge House school is in the immediate vicinity.
